Bitcoin Is Not at Quantum Risk — But Traders Still Overreact

Is Bitcoin Really Under Threat?
Headlines scream about quantum computers breaking Bitcoin, but the reality is far less dramatic. Only a tiny fraction of BTC is exposed, and practical danger is decades away.
still, like Ethereum today, Bitcoin’s strength is often invisible. When technology works perfectly and the network runs smoothly, the market doesn’t cheer — it just ignores it. That’s exactly what can make the next big move explosive.
How Bitcoin Could Be Vulnerable — And Why It Isn’t
Bitcoin relies on two cryptographic pillars:
ECDSA + Schnorr signatures
SHA-256 hashing
Quantum computers could theoretically attack these. But only 1.6 million BTC in legacy addresses are exposed — and just 10,200 BTC could realistically move markets.
Even if a quantum hacker existed today, cracking these wallets would take years per address. Panic is unnecessary — just like traders ignore Ethereum’s upgrades even when fees drop and Layer 1 activity surges.
The Quantum Computing Reality Check
Modern quantum computers are far from powerful enough.Google’s Willow has 105 qubits; breaking Bitcoin in a day would need 13 million — 100,000× stronger.
Experts predict cryptographically relevant quantum computers won’t appear until the 2030s or later.
So the immediate threat? None.
And the psychological threat? That’s another story.

1️⃣ The "10,200 BTC" Reality
While 1.6M BTC sits in legacy addresses, CoinShares argues only 10,200 BTC are in large enough chunks to actually cause market disruption. The rest? Fragmented across 32,000+ tiny wallets that aren't worth the "cost" of cracking.
2️⃣ Hardware is Nowhere Close
To crack a key in 24 hours, you’d need a quantum computer with 13 MILLION qubits.
Google’s state-of-the-art "Willow"? It has 105 qubits.
We are looking at a 100,000x gap in tech.
3️⃣ No "Burning" Allowed
Some want to "burn" old vulnerable coins. CoinShares says: ABSOLUTELY NOT. Violating property rights is against the Bitcoin ethos. Instead, expect a slow, steady upgrade to post-quantum signatures.

#quantum Threat to Bitcoin Delayed Decades

Adam Back says quantum computers won't threaten bitcoin for at least 20 to 40 years.

The cryptographer cited in #Satoshi 's white paper was pushing back against claims that SHA-256 could be cracked within two to five years. Current quantum systems aren't even close.
